Ensuring Maritime Operations: The Importance of Timely Spare Part Shipping
Keeping maritime operations running smoothly relies heavily on a well-oiled supply chain. One key element of this chain is the timely shipping of spare parts. When vessels encounter unexpected problems, prompt access to replacement components can mean the difference between minimal downtime and costly delays. A strong spare parts logistics system ensures that repairs are completed swiftly, minimizing disruption to schedules and sustaining productivity.
This dependability in spare part delivery has a direct impact on a company's bottom line. Reduced downtime translates to lower operational costs, increased revenue generation, and enhanced customer satisfaction. By prioritizing timely spare part shipping, maritime businesses can enhance their operations and remain advantageous in a demanding market.
Specialized Shipping Solutions for Bulk Vessel Spares
Securing prompt delivery of vital spares for bulk vessels involves a distinct set of challenges. These include the need for streamlined logistics to handle large quantities, compliance with rigorous international regulations, and the demanding nature of many spare part shipments.
To overcome these obstacles, specialized shipping solutions offer a range of dedicated services designed to facilitate the successful and timely transport of vessel spares.
